(Ord. 2013-001, <br />2013; Ord. 2011-013, 2011; Ord. O-2006-01, 2006; Ord. 96-19 (part), 1996; Ord. 83-Z-2 (part), 1983: Res. <br />83-10, 1983) <br />17.16.030 Minimum lot requirements. <br />1. Minimum lot sizes in the R zone are as follows: <br />a. Single family dwelling, seven thousand two hundred (7,200) square feet; <br />b. Two (2) family dwelling, ten thousand (10,000) square feet. <br />2. The minimum lot depth shall be one hundred (100) feet. <br />3. The minimum average lot width shall be sixty-five (65) feet.
